The Most Powerful Thing You Can Do On LinkedIn

LinkedIn is a limitless goldmine for finding a career. It is best for promoting your business and creating a good profile. You can start taking advantage of LinkedIn using these few simple suggestions.

  • You should set up job alerts and look for new jobs related to your field. You can also use LinkedIn groups to stay updated.
  • Set a public profile so it is visible to everyone. This way, people can easily approach you for business-related purposes.
  • Using the right keywords can increase the effectiveness of your profile. Using certain keywords in your post might show it up when someone searches for a related topic.
  • Join and post in groups to build your credibility and brand. Posting in LinkedIn groups is an excellent way to meet others related to your business.
  • Stay up to date with news related to your business and build your reliability as an expert in your field.
  • Ask current and former colleagues to jot down a personal recommendation about you. They can talk about their experience working with you. They can comment on your unique skills, abilities, and accomplishments. These will appear on your profile. This can be strong and effective. Written recommendations in black and white are accurate indications. They can back up the claims you create in your profile.
  • It’s the mix of the amount and quality of your activity in groups. These include the completeness and attractiveness of your profile, recommendations, connections, and more. They create the private brand you impart upon the professional world at large.

LinkedIn is one of the best platforms to build connections with other professionals. You can attract potential business partners, employees, or clients. LinkedIn does not have the impression like other social media networks do. For example, Facebook, Instagram, and Snapchat. Growing on LinkedIn will drive an audience that could increase your revenue.
